US fabless chip manufacturer Qualcomm will be holding the annual Snapdragon Technology Summit in some hours’ time in Hawaii. The event is expected to see the company announce the new generation of Snapdragon mobile platform.

Ahead of the event, VideoCardZ claims to have obtained the PPT slides of the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 flagship processor. The purported slides show the highlights of the features and specifications of the flagship processor. The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 is seen to be manufactured using a 4nm process. This brings about a 20% increase in the CPU performance while the power consumption is reduced by 30%.

The chipset is also equipped with the 4th generation Adreno GPU of which the GPU performance is increased by 30%. Also, the new GPU brings about a reduction in the power consumption by 25% while the Vulkan performance is increased by 60%.

The slides also show the Snapdragon processor is equipped with the seventh-generation Qualcomm AI engine and the third-generation Qualcomm Sensing Hub. It is also equipped with Snapdragon sight bringing an improvement in the image output. It also brings support 5G Modem-RF, WiFi 6/6E.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 1

In addition, the PPT slides show that Qualcomm will cooperate with Razer to launch a developer kit for handheld gaming devices equipped with the Snapdragon G3x chip. The device provides a 120Hz HDR OLED display and is equipped with a 6000mAh large battery.
